Posting Summary
Rutgers, The State University of New Jersey, is seeking an IT Associate Director for the The Office of Information Technology (OIT)-Enterprise Service Delivery. This position is responsible for creating and maintaining a highly agile and cohesive structure to effectively coordinate enterprise IT support for Rutgers University, New Brunswick.

Among the key duties of this position are the following:
  • Provides direct guidance to three areas: NB F/S Help Desk, After-hours support and LMS Help Desk.
  • Analyzes and creates seamless processes (both user facing and internal).
  • Optimizes resources to achieve the highest levels of productivity, quality and client satisfaction.
  • Collaborates with the NB student Help Desk leadership as well as OIT Help Desk leaders for Newark and Camden.
  • Serves as a back-up for the Associate Director responsible for the NB student Help Desk.

Immunization Requirements

Under Policy 60.1.35 Immunization Policy for Rutgers Employees and Prospective Employees, Rutgers University requires all prospective employees to provide proof that they are fully vaccinated and have received a booster (where eligible) against COVID-19 prior to commencement of employment, unless the University has granted the individual a medical or religious exemption. Employees who are not eligible for a booster at the time of an offer of employment must provide proof they have received a booster upon eligibility and upload proof of same. Under Policy 100.3.1 Immunization Policy for Covered Individuals, if employment will commence during Flu Season, Rutgers University may require certain prospective employees to provide proof that they are vaccinated against Seasonal Influenza for the current Flu Season, unless the University has granted the individual a medical or religious exemption. Additional infection control and safety policies may apply. Prospective employees should speak with their hiring manager to determine which policies apply to the role or position for which they are applying. Failure to provide proof of vaccination for any required vaccines or obtain a medical or religious exemption from the University will result in rescission of a candidate’s offer of employment or disciplinary action up to and including termination.
